Original Description
Antonietta Brandeis’ The Dogana and San Giorgio, Venice captures the timeless allure of the Venetian lagoon with poetic precision. Painted in the late 19th century, this work exemplifies Brandeis’ mastery of veduta (architectural view painting), blending detailed realism with a delicate luminosity characteristic of her tutelage under Czech artist Karel Javůrek. The composition juxtaposes the ornate Dogana da Mar (Venice’s historic customs house) with the Palladian grandeur of San Giorgio Maggiore across the shimmering water, their reflections dissolving into impressionistic brushstrokes—a nod to emerging modern trends. Though lesser-known than male contemporaries like Canaletto, Brandeis’ works are gaining recognition for their meticulous craftsmanship and unique female perspective in a male-dominated genre. This painting is a historical document of Venice’s architectural splendor and a bridge between academic tradition and atmospheric spontaneity.
